MURAL is on a mission to inspire and connect imagination workers globally.

MURAL provides digital workspaces for guided visual collaboration to 95 percent of the Fortune 100. Different from online whiteboarding and design software, the MURAL® platform transforms teamwork by making meetings and workshops interactive experiences designed for problem solving, play, and imagination. Tens of thousands of teams at companies such as IBM, Intuit, Facebook, Publicis Sapient, SAP, Thoughtworks, and Atlassian use the MURAL platform to foster imaginative teamwork and turn shared ideas into a shared reality—at any time and from anywhere.

Headquartered in San Francisco, California, but driven by a remote-first, global mindset, MURAL employs over 800 “MURAListas” around the world. MURAL is on a mission to level up teamwork with imagination so that working together is more fun and innovation happens faster. MURAL has raised $200M in financing to date and is growing rapidly to fulfill its mission.

YOUR MISSION

As Manager of MURAL’s Marketing Analytics team, you will own the measurement framework Marketing uses to understand and optimize our demand and customer lifecycle. This includes defining department-level KPIs and monitoring mechanisms that bring our data to life and make it actionable. You and your team will expand the measurement, data visualization and data storytelling capabilities of a fast-paced, growth-focused Marketing organization. This will include supporting ad-hoc in-depth analyses as well as ongoing dashboards, reporting and optimization efforts.

As the in-house experts on Marketing measurement and our data model, you and your team will partner cross-functionally with Product, Sales and BI to support the development of company goals, models, dashboards, reports and analysis. Your expertise will also support internal marketing technology roadmap projects, where you’ll advise us and our Data Team on data flows within custom integrations. This position reports to the Director of Marketing Technology & Operations.

YOUR PROFILE

  • 5+ years of experience in marketing analytics, digital analytics and/or product analytics
  • Demonstrable experience developing measurement practices at a SaaS company
  • Experience working across the full analytics lifecycle, including data ingestion, ETL, data modelling, dashboard development, analysis and optimization
  • Proficiency with data programming languages, including SQL and Python
  • Firm grasp of marketing concepts like Lifecycle Stages, Lead Scoring, Conversion Rates
  • Experience creating and maintaining reports and dashboards with a BI tool such as Tableau, Looker or PowerBI
  • Strong understanding of data visualization best practices.
  • Business acumen that allows you to navigate through complexity and ambiguity
  • Strong communication skills to tell data stories to non-technical audience
  • Enjoys being exposed to new ideas, learning new skills and new technologies
  • An entrepreneurial drive to question, innovate and iterate
  • Open to working remotely with a global team
  • Excellent English written and verbal communication skills

Ideally you have...

  • Proficiency with Tableau
  • Experience working with or at a product-led growth (PLG) company
  • Experience building and managing an analytics team
